Dominicana SkyHigh Adds Santo Domingo – San Juan Route to Booking Engine with Appealing Rates and Schedules

Dominicana SkyHigh Adds Santo Domingo – San Juan Route to Booking Engine with Appealing Rates and Schedules

Post its successful launch of the Santo Domingo – Aguadilla flight, SkyHigh Dominicana is now offering the Santo Domingo – San Juan route in Puerto Rico through their booking and sales platform. This new route aims to enhance the connection between the two Caribbean countries and simultaneously promote tourism for both of them.

As a reminder, on September 3, we informed you that the airline had begun selling tickets for this route to travel agencies after a five year hiatus (beginning in 2019). SkyHigh has now set a convenient timetable suitable for families, executives, and people traveling for either business or leisure from both capital cities. Each city provides plenty of offers and attractions such as cultural, historical, gastronomic, and urban spots as well as nearby beaches.

SkyHigh DominicanaThe ticket prices start from US$299.92, with all taxes included (availability based on class and other baggage details). Flights depart daily from the Dominican capital at 2:30 p.m. and arrive in the Puerto Rican capital at 3:30 p.m., the total duration being one hour. The return flight departs at 4:30 p.m. and reaches the destination by 5:30 p.m.

This results in SkyHigh Dominicana offering a total of 9 weekly flights to Puerto Rico, connecting the western part and the central metropolitan area. Last Thursday, during the Aguadilla flight announcement, the possibility of a future connection with Punta Cana was discussed, but is currently being negotiated and its final details have yet to be confirmed.

SkyHigh Dominicana is focussed on enhancing air connectivity within the Caribbean through its main operations center at the José Francisco Peña Gómez International Airport of the Americas (AILA – JFPG). They aim to connect to more destinations, with plans to even extend their operations to the North American continent.

At the upcoming IFTM Top Resa in Paris, SkyHigh Dominicana will be showcasing its regional routes to interested companies for establishing connectivity, as well as to air service suppliers, and many other airline industry participants that are part of such a world-class event.
